黄河三角洲农业生态地质环境综合研究 被引量:6

Comprehensive Study on Agricultural Ecologic and Geological Environment of the Yellow River Delta

摘要 为了遏制黄河三角洲农业生态地质环境质量急剧恶化的势头,促进黄河三角洲经济、资源与生态农业地质环境的协调发展,运用地质科学、农业生态科学、环境科学和地球化学等多种方法,系统分析了黄河三角洲农业生态地质环境特征,认为黄河三角洲是在海洋动力与河流动力共同作用下形成的,受特殊的海、陆、河与湿地相互交替演化且相互制约的脆弱生态地质环境和人类活动尤其是不科学的掠夺性资源开发等因素的影响,引发了土壤盐渍化、土壤沙化、土壤沼泽化、水土污染、地下水降落漏斗、海咸水入侵和地面沉降等地质环境问题,改变了农业生态地质环境的演化特征甚至方向。采用专家模糊聚类法把农业生态地质环境划分为3种类型、11个地质环境单元,提出了合理开发利用水资源、环境治理、农业生态地质环境质量监测等修复措施。 In order to contain the momentum of sudden worsening of agricultural, ecological and geological environment in the Yellow River delta and promote the balanced development of economy, resources and agricultural, ecological and geological environment in the Yellow River delta, the paper systematically analyzes the characteristics of the environment of the delta by using various kinds of methods of geology, agricultural ecology, environment sciences and geochemistry. It considers that the Yellow River delta is shaped under the joint action of motive powers of marine and river. It has caused the geological environment problems of soil salinization, desertification, paludification, soil and water pollution, ground water funneling, seawater intrusion and ground settlement and changed the evolution characteristics even the orientation of agricultural ecologic and geological environment effected by special alternated evolution of marine, land, river and wetlands, weak and restricted ecologic and geological environmental and human non-scientific and devastated resources development. The paper divides the environment into 3 categories and 11 elements and puts forward rehabilitation measures of rationally developing and utilizing water resources, environmental management and monitoring of agricultural ecologic and geological environment by using the method of expert fuzzy clustering.
